The Tesla Model Y has quickly become the patrol vehicle of choice for police departments across the US, including South Pasadena in California and Anaheim PD in California. Thanks to UP.FIT, a division of Unplugged Performance, departments benefit from the next generation of fleet vehicles with efficiency and safety of law enforcement in mind. In fact, one standout product from our innovative future fleet vehicles was the Forged PD wheel for the Model Y, Model 3, and Cybertruck. Its performance and durability were simply too good to keep exclusive to only clients of UP.FIT, so it only made sense to make it an available product to the general public.
Now, civilian Tesla Model Y owners can take advantage of the police proven durability of these wheels. The wheels boast an improved curb rash protection thanks to a half inch narrower width, improved performance courtesy of a 17% lighter wheel over an OEM 19” Wheel, and a more comfortable longer ride due to police pursuit 245/55R18 BFGoodrich Elite Force Tires. This wheel and tire package is offered directly through Unplugged Performance, taking the guesswork out of finding the right fitment for your Model Y.
